Transaction 503f84176b77e8032d62a72e98b9f18aa7e37ac3287fe717597671c1c1f01f5e

5 Input
2 Outputs
  • 503f84176b77e8032d62a72e98b9f18aa7e37ac3287fe717597671c1c1f01f5e:0
  • value  782633
    address  15ZgECsgsjWRR4dQppfeJGtrUFNkuooTmb
  • 503f84176b77e8032d62a72e98b9f18aa7e37ac3287fe717597671c1c1f01f5e:1
  • value  222640
    address  bc1q3zt552lp5heagg7aeuzmpfhmjg5emcycd39jcr